5 Fig Recipes to Make: Fresh and Canned Options for Every Season

Figs are a unique fruit cherished for their sweet, honey-like flavor and chewy texture. Whether fresh or canned, figs bring a luxurious touch to both savory and sweet dishes. Since fresh figs are seasonal and can be hard to find year-round, using canned figs is a great alternative to enjoy their rich taste any time. Here are five delicious fig recipes that work perfectly with fresh or canned figs, so you can savor this incredible fruit no matter the season.

1. Fresh Fig and Goat Cheese Salad

This salad is a perfect balance of sweet and tangy. Toss fresh or drained canned figs with mixed greens, crumbled goat cheese, toasted walnuts, and a drizzle of balsamic glaze. The figs add natural sweetness that pairs beautifully with the creamy cheese and crunchy nuts. For canned figs, rinse lightly and pat dry to reduce syrupiness before adding to the salad.

2. Fig and Prosciutto Crostini

A quick and elegant appetizer, fig and prosciutto crostini combines toasted baguette slices topped with fig slices, thin prosciutto, and a smear of creamy ricotta or mascarpone cheese. Fresh figs bring a juicy burst, while canned figs offer a consistent sweetness—just drain well before layering. Finish with a sprinkle of fresh thyme or a drizzle of honey for an irresistible bite.

3. Baked Brie with Fig Compote

Elevate your cheese board by baking a wheel of brie topped with a luscious fig compote made from fresh or canned figs simmered with a touch of brown sugar and lemon juice. The compote’s sweet richness melts into the cheese, creating a gooey, flavorful treat perfect for entertaining. Use canned figs directly from the jar, chopped finely for a smooth texture.

4. Fig and Almond Overnight Oats

Start your day with wholesome overnight oats sweetened naturally with figs. Combine rolled oats, milk (or plant-based alternative), chopped fresh or canned figs, and a handful of almonds. Let the mixture soak overnight in the fridge. The figs soften and release their sweetness, making a creamy and satisfying breakfast. For canned figs, rinse to remove excess syrup for a less sweet version.

5. Fig Jam Glazed Chicken

Create a sweet-savory glaze for baked or grilled chicken using fig jam made from fresh or canned figs, combined with Dijon mustard and a splash of balsamic vinegar. This glaze caramelizes beautifully on the chicken, giving it a rich flavor and glossy finish. To make your own jam from canned figs, puree them with a bit of sugar and lemon juice, then simmer until thickened.

Canned figs are an excellent pantry staple for those times when fresh figs aren’t available. They retain much of their natural sweetness and texture, making them perfect for cooking, baking, or spreading. Just be sure to drain and rinse canned figs when you want to reduce syrupy sweetness.

Figs are incredibly versatile and add a gourmet flair to many dishes. With these five recipes, you can enjoy figs year-round, fresh or canned. Whether you’re preparing a light salad, a decadent appetizer, or a comforting breakfast, figs bring a unique sweetness that enhances any meal.
